My Buying Guides on Raspberry Pi Battery Case

Why I Look for a Raspberry Pi Battery Case

When I choose a Raspberry Pi battery case, I want more than just a shell. I look for a case that can power my Pi reliably, protect it from damage, and still keep everything portable. For me, the best battery case makes it easy to use the Raspberry Pi on the go without worrying about cables, sudden shutdowns, or overheating.

What I Check Before Buying

Before I buy, I always compare a few important features. These help me avoid cases that look good but do not perform well in real use.

Battery Capacity

I pay close attention to the battery capacity, usually measured in mAh. A higher capacity means longer runtime, but I also consider how much power my Raspberry Pi setup actually needs. If I use extra accessories like a camera, keyboard, or Wi-Fi dongle, I know I will need more battery life.

Power Output

I make sure the case can deliver stable power at the right voltage and current. If the output is weak, my Raspberry Pi may restart or behave unpredictably. I prefer a battery case that gives consistent power, especially when I run demanding projects.

Compatibility

I always confirm that the case fits my specific Raspberry Pi model. Some cases are made for Raspberry Pi 4, while others fit Pi 3, Pi Zero, or older versions. I also check whether it leaves enough room for ports, GPIO access, and any add-ons I use.

Port Access

I like a case that does not block the USB, HDMI, power, or microSD ports unless I have a good reason for it. Easy access saves me time when I need to connect devices or update software.

Cooling and Ventilation

Heat is something I never ignore. If the battery case traps too much warmth, my Raspberry Pi can throttle performance. I look for built-in ventilation, fan support, or enough space for cooling accessories.

Build Quality

I prefer a case made from durable material that can handle travel and everyday use. A solid case protects the board, battery, and connections from bumps and scratches.

Types of Raspberry Pi Battery Cases I Consider

Over time, I have seen a few common types of battery cases, and each one serves a different purpose.

All-in-One Battery Cases

These combine the case and battery into one unit. I like them for simple portable projects because they are compact and easy to carry.

Cases with Power Banks

Some setups use a separate power bank inside or alongside the case. I find these useful when I want flexibility and easy battery replacement.

HAT-Based Battery Cases

These attach directly to the Raspberry Pi GPIO pins or use a HAT design. I consider them when I want a cleaner setup and integrated power management.

Features I Find Most Useful

When I compare options, I look for features that make the battery case easier and safer to use.

  • Power switch: I like being able to turn the Pi on and off easily.
  • Battery indicators: LED lights or display indicators help me track charge level.
  • Charging support: I prefer cases that are easy to recharge without removing everything.
  • Safe shutdown function: This helps protect my files and SD card from corruption.
  • Mounting options: I value cases that support accessories or can be attached to other hardware.

How I Match the Case to My Project

I do not buy based on looks alone. I think about what I want to build. For a portable media player, I need longer battery life. For a robotics project, I need stable power and a strong case. For a learning setup, I may prefer something simple, affordable, and easy to assemble.

My Budget Considerations

I try to balance price with quality. A very cheap battery case may save money at first, but if it has poor battery life or weak protection, I may end up replacing it sooner. I usually prefer spending a little more for better reliability, especially if the Raspberry Pi is part of an important project.
